Bug 1226002

Summary: KDE style file picker in Firefox uses XWayland unless user manually install libqt5-qtwayland
Product: [openSUSE] openSUSE Tumbleweed Reporter: Pavel Urusov <pavel.urusov>
Component: FirefoxAssignee: Factory Mozilla <factory-mozilla>
Status: RESOLVED DUPLICATE QA Contact: E-mail List <qa-bugs>
Severity: Normal    
Priority: P5 - None    
Version: Current   
Target Milestone: ---   
Hardware: x86-64   
OS: openSUSE Tumbleweed   
Whiteboard:
Found By: --- Services Priority:
Business Priority: Blocker: ---
Marketing QA Status: --- IT Deployment: ---
Attachments: Default KDE-style file picker in Firefox runs under XWayland and does not respect scaling

Description Pavel Urusov 2024-06-05 11:22:20 UTC
Created attachment 875326 [details]
Default KDE-style file picker in Firefox runs under XWayland and does not respect scaling

The native KDE-style file picker in Firefox uses XWayland on default Tumbleweed/Plasma installation. That is not a huge problem in itself, but the XWayland picker does not respect the scaling settings.

However, I noticed that after installing SwayWM in addition to KDE Plasma 6, Firefox switched to the Wayland file picker.

Removing SwayWM and its dependencies breaks the file picker again.

After investigating the issue, I discovered that the issue goes away if I manually install libqt5-qtwayland.
Comment 1 Pavel Urusov 2024-06-05 11:26:45 UTC
System information:

Operating System: openSUSE Tumbleweed 20240531
KDE Plasma Version: 6.0.5
KDE Frameworks Version: 6.2.0
Qt Version: 6.7.1
Kernel Version: 6.9.3-1-default (64-bit)
Graphics Platform: Wayland
Processors: 20 × 12th Gen Intel® Core™ i7-12700
Memory: 31.1 GiB of RAM
Graphics Processor: AMD Radeon RX 560 Series
Comment 2 hui 2024-06-27 12:23:08 UTC
.

*** This bug has been marked as a duplicate of bug 1224995 ***